Green Aquariums

Where can you climb through the layers of the rain forest and descend into a 100,000 gallon “Flooded Forest” tank, where freshwater fish cruise overhead? Where can you see a 2 ½ acre Living Roof, an expansive solar canopy, an extensive water reclamation system, and walls insulated with recycled blue jeans? Only in San Francisco!

Smart Green Travel takes you to the Greenest Aquariums in the country, including San Francisco’s Steinhart Aquarium, the largest green public platinum-rated building in the world, for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ED).

Male Penguins, have got it rough! When you visit the newly updated Penguin exhibit at the Monterey Bay Aquarium, visit the Penguins for more than ten minutes. Witness the relentless testing of the females during the creation of her nest, insisting that he help her build the nest on her complicated terms. The male penguin, tirelessly, works each long day, hauling twigs and eggs up the mountain, drops them in front of her, and awaits her approval.  She often declines and forces him to leave, once again, down the mountain, to then return to the nest, with something steinhart-aquarium-san-franciscomore to her liking. They are monogamous, and the female is testing her mates endurance, as husband, and father, as he spends all day, for many weeks, climbing a small mountain, in the exhibit, pushing wooden eggs and twigs, up to the Mother’s nest,  only to have her reject his efforts repeatedly. Back down the hill he goes, to start the process all over again.  Male Penguins repeat this pattern countless times a day, and have the most exhausting schedule  I’ve ever witnessed of any animals in captivity.
